Position Overview
The Strategic Operations Manager is part of the Payments Business Unit team. Reporting to the Chief of Staff, this role sits at the intersection of strategy and execution, partnering closely with business unit leadership to both keep the operating engine running smoothly and help shape the next phase of growth.
You’ll Split Your Time Between
Operational leadership — supporting the operating rhythm of the business unit, including key recurring meetings and quarterly planning cadences with the broader enterprise.
Strategic projects — identifying, sizing, and evaluating new growth opportunities, markets, products, and partnerships.
This is an ideal role for a structured problem-solving with strong business judgment, who is excited to partner with leadership and drive initiatives from analysis through execution.
Key Responsibilities
Business Unit Operations & Cadence
- Own and support the operating rhythm of the business unit, including monthly and quarterly cadences with the Enterprise
- Develop agendas, materials, and analyses to ensure meetings are efficient, data-driven, and decision-oriented
- Track follow-ups, decisions, and action items to drive accountability and execution
- Partner closely with Payments BU leadership, Finance and Enterprise Strategy
- Act as connective tissue between the business unit and the broader enterprise, ensuring alignment on priorities and decisions
- Influence prioritization and investment decisions through clear insights, structured analysis, and strong executive communication
- Lead and support strategic analyses to identify and evaluate new growth opportunities (e.g., new markets, products, customer segments, partnerships, or M&A themes)
- Build market sizing, financial models, and business cases to support investment decisions
- Conduct competitive and industry research to inform strategic recommendations
- Support senior leaders with clear, concise recommendations and executive-ready materials
- 4+ years of professional experience, ideally with a background in management consulting, investment banking, or private equity
- Strong analytical and financial modeling skills; comfortable building structured analyses from scratch
- Exceptional written and verbal communication skills, including the ability to synthesize complex topics for executive audiences
- Highly organized, detail-oriented, and able to manage multiple workstreams simultaneously
- Comfortable operating in ambiguity and moving between strategic thinking and tactical execution
- Startup or high-growth company experience is a plus
- Experience in healthcare, payments, or fintech is a plus but not required
- High visibility and direct exposure to senior leadership
- Opportunity to influence both day-to-day execution and long-term strategy
- Broad scope across operations, strategy, and growth
- Strong platform for future leadership roles in strategy, operations, or general management
